Description

Great opportunity to own a 3 bed, 2.5 bath home in Franconia Township and the highly desired Souderton School District! Located on a beautiful, level 1.3 acre lot, this home has been well loved for many years and is ready for your own personal touch! Entering through the foyer, on the left you'll find an open concept from living room to dining room and kitchen, which then leads into a large sunroom with great natural light and a cathedral ceiling! To the right, the hallway leads to a full bath and three bedrooms that include a master suite with a full bathroom. On the the lower level there is a large family room, laundry and utility room, a powder room and hall/foyer area that leads to a HEATED, 2 car garage! The lower level also offers a large, fully enclosed workshop in the rear of the home. This a great bonus space that has potential for many uses! This home also includes a well maintained, 5 zone boiler with domestic hot water. 2021-02-27

751 Lower Rd, Souderton, PA 18964 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,268 sqft single-family home built in 1971. This property is not currently available for sale. 751 Lower Rd was last sold on Mar 25, 2021 for $400,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 751 Lower Rd is $571,200.
